Job description

Job Overview

The Superintendent is responsible for overseeing all on‑site activities for construction projects, including site access, scheduling, logistics, safety, quality, and project closeout. They work closely with the Project Manager from pre‑construction through close‑out to ensure the project plan is executed and all requirements are met.

Responsibilities
  • Active participation in RFP responses, including developing presentations and participating in the pitch.
  • Manage pre‑construction scheduling, logistics, and planning.
  • Create, maintain, and update accurate and detailed project schedules and weekly field updates.
  • Manage field team, trade partners, and owner vendors with proactive communication.
  • Proactively recognize and resolve on‑site challenges and issues for a timely resolution with minimum cost impact.
  • Serve as an ambassador for Clune’s safety culture and OSHA standards, maintaining a safe work environment and leading safety meetings.
  • Maintain project documentation on site.
  • Manage the close‑out process to obtain all required inspections, ensure timely completion of punch list work, successful commissioning of equipment, and training of the owner and/or owner vendors.
  • Review general conditions and labor requirements with the project management team, keeping financial commitments top of mind throughout the project.
  • Become proficient in, and utilize, Clune’s established systems and technology to work efficiently and to the highest standards.
  • Participate in business development and client relationship management by attending industry events, networking, and developing beneficial working relationships with clients and designers.
  • Attend career fairs and client/industry events.
  • Contribute to the growth of the company by participating in the intern program as well as mentoring interns, project engineers, and APMs.
  • Role model professionally for interns, project engineers, and assistant superintendents.
Supervisory Responsibilities
  • May have supervisory responsibilities of an Assistant Superintendent, Project Engineer, Field Assistant, and/or an intern.
